À propos de ce contenu audio

In this episode, Ally and Scot discuss their experience of leaving cults. Scot shares about leaving the United Pentecostal Church (UPC), which he was born into. Ally's experience of leaving the UPC was more combative, as her entire church left due to disagreements with the organization's teachings. Ally and Scot share personal stories and offer advice for those who have experienced high-control groups. They also address the consequences of leaving, including being labeled as bitter and the loss of relationships. They emphasize the importance of recognizing unhealthy practices and questioning beliefs. They also discuss the appeal of charismatic leaders and the deceptive tactics they employ. The episode highlights the abusive history of Mike Bickle and the International House of Prayer (IHOPKC) as an example of how charismatic leaders can deceive their followers. The conversation concludes with a discussion on the cult-like nature of multi-site churches and the reduction of people to consumers in the cult of capitalism.
